Touring cycling routes around Aubussargues traverse a diverse landscape in the Gard department of southern France. The region features a mix of forests, scrubland, vineyards, and olive groves. Terrain includes both flat sections and hilly areas, with the foothills of the Cévennes providing varied elevation. Natural features such as the Gardon Gorges and Mont Bouquet contribute to the area's distinct character.

Best touring cycling routes around Aubussargues

  • The most popular touring cycling route is Maison Carrée (Roman Temple) – Collias loop from Aubussargues, a 40.7 miles (65.6 km) trail that takes 4 hours 3 minutes to complete. This route features significant elevation gain and passes by historical Roman landmarks.
  • Another top favourite among local touring cyclists is Mont Bouquet Watchtower – Bourricot Pass loop from Garrigues-Sainte-Eulalie, a difficult 33.6 miles (54.1 km) path. This route includes challenging climbs to viewpoints like Mont Bouquet, offering expansive views of the surrounding area.
  • Local touring cyclists also love the Mas de l'Aveugle – Historic Village of Vézénobres loop from Aubussargues, a 30.8 miles (49.5 km) trail leading through varied agricultural landscapes, often completed in about 3 hours 9 minutes.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many touring cycling routes are available around Aubussargues?

There are over 180 touring cycling routes around Aubussargues, offering a wide range of options for different skill levels and preferences. These routes are highly rated by the komoot community, with an average score of 4.3 stars from over 340 reviews.

What kind of terrain can I expect on touring cycling routes near Aubussargues?

The terrain around Aubussargues is quite diverse, featuring a picturesque blend of natural environments. You can expect to cycle through forests, scrubland (garrigue), vineyards, and olive groves. The routes offer both flat sections and hilly areas, particularly as you approach the foothills of the Cévennes, providing varied cycling experiences.

Are there any easy or family-friendly touring cycling routes in the area?

Yes, there are 38 easy touring cycling routes around Aubussargues, many of which are suitable for families. These routes often wind through charming villages and agricultural landscapes, providing a more relaxed experience. The region's greenways (voies vertes) also offer gentle, traffic-free paths.

What are some notable landmarks or natural features I can see along the touring cycling routes?

Many routes pass by significant natural and historical landmarks. You can explore the breathtaking Gardon Gorges, offering stunning views like Le Castellas – View over the Gardon. Other highlights include the La Baume Saint-Vérédème Cave and Chapel and the Source of the Eure. The famous Pont du Gard, a UNESCO World Heritage site, is also accessible via several cycling routes.

Are there challenging routes for experienced touring cyclists?

Absolutely. For experienced touring cyclists seeking a challenge, there are 49 difficult routes around Aubussargues. These often include significant elevation gains, such as the climbs towards Mont Bouquet, which is the highest point in the immediate area. An example is the Mont Bouquet Watchtower – Bourricot Pass loop from Garrigues-Sainte-Eulalie, which features challenging ascents and expansive views.

What is the best time of year for touring cycling in Aubussargues?

The temperate climate of the Gard department makes Aubussargues suitable for touring cycling throughout much of the year. Spring and autumn generally offer the most pleasant conditions with mild temperatures and beautiful scenery. Summer can be warm, but early morning rides are often enjoyable, and the region's diverse landscapes provide shade in some areas.

Are there any circular touring cycling routes available?

Yes, many of the touring cycling routes around Aubussargues are designed as loops, allowing you to start and finish in the same location. For example, the Maison Carrée (Roman Temple) – Collias loop from Aubussargues is a popular option that takes you past historical Roman landmarks.

Can I find cafes or places to stop for refreshments along the routes?

Yes, many touring cycling routes in the Aubussargues area pass through charming villages like Uzès, Garrigues-Sainte Eulalie, Collorgues, and Bourdic. These villages often have local cafes, bakeries, and restaurants where you can stop for refreshments, enjoy local cuisine, and take a break.

What kind of views can I expect on the touring cycling routes?

The routes offer a variety of scenic views, from the lush vineyards and olive groves to the rugged scrubland and forests. Higher elevations, such as those found on routes climbing Mont Bouquet, provide magnificent panoramic views of the surrounding Gard region and the Cévennes foothills. You'll also encounter picturesque river bends and gorges, like those along the Gardon.

Are there options for longer touring cycling adventures?

Yes, the region offers routes of varying distances. For longer adventures, consider routes that connect to nearby towns or explore more extensive loops. For instance, the Maison Carrée (Roman Temple) – Nîmes Arena loop from Arpaillargues-et-Aureilhac covers over 70 kilometers, allowing for a full day of exploration and sightseeing.

What is the average difficulty level of touring cycling routes in Aubussargues?

The routes around Aubussargues cater to all levels, but the majority are of moderate difficulty, with 93 such routes available. These routes balance scenic beauty with manageable challenges, often including rolling hills and varied terrain without being overly strenuous.

Are there any routes that focus on agricultural landscapes?

Many routes specifically highlight the region's agricultural heritage, winding through extensive vineyards and olive groves. The Mas de l'Aveugle – Historic Village of Vézénobres loop from Aubussargues is a great example, leading you through varied agricultural landscapes and charming rural settings.
